\n\n\n\n Wie man KI-Agenten für Indie-Spiele einsetzt - ClawDev Wie man KI-Agenten für Indie-Spiele einsetzt - ClawDev \n

Wie man KI-Agenten für Indie-Spiele einsetzt

📖 6 min read1,012 wordsUpdated Mar 29, 2026

Integration von KI-Agenten in die Entwicklung unabhängiger Spiele

Als Entwickler unabhängiger Spiele gehört eine der spannendsten Herausforderungen dazu, ein immersives und fesselndes Erlebnis mit begrenzten Ressourcen zu schaffen. In den letzten Jahren haben die Fortschritte bei KI-Agenten neue Möglichkeiten für kleine Teams wie unser eigenes eröffnet, Spiele zu entwickeln, die in Bezug auf Komplexität und Tiefe mit größeren Produktionen konkurrieren. In diesem Artikel werde ich praktische Tipps teilen, wie man KI-Agenten in der Entwicklung unabhängiger Spiele einsetzen kann, basierend auf meinen eigenen Erfahrungen und Beobachtungen auf diesem Gebiet.

Die Rolle der KI-Agenten verstehen

KI-Agenten sind im Wesentlichen Algorithmen oder Systeme, die entwickelt wurden, um Aufgaben autonom auszuführen. Im Kontext von Spielen können sie verwendet werden, um nicht spielbare Charaktere (NSCs), Umweltinteraktionen oder sogar prozedurale Inhaltserzeugung zu erstellen. Diese Agenten können das Spielerlebnis bereichern, indem sie Tiefe, Unberechenbarkeit und Intelligenz zu den Spielelementen hinzufügen.

Fesselnde NSCs erstellen

Eine der häufigsten Anwendungen von KI-Agenten in unabhängigen Spielen ist die Entwicklung von NSCs. Anstatt jede Interaktion manuell zu programmieren, können KI-Agenten so programmiert werden, dass sie dynamisch auf die Aktionen der Spieler reagieren. Zum Beispiel haben wir in einem Spiel, an dem ich kürzlich gearbeitet habe, KI-Agenten eingesetzt, um das Verhalten der Dorfbewohner in einem fantastischen Setting zu steuern. Jeder Dorfbewohner hatte eine Reihe von Zielen und Bedürfnissen, wie Hunger oder Sicherheit, die ihre täglichen Routinen und Interaktionen mit dem Spieler beeinflussten. Dies schuf eine lebendige Welt, in der die Dorfbewohner eher wie echte Charaktere wirkten als wie statische Objekte.

Um dies umzusetzen, beginnen Sie damit, grundlegende Attribute für jeden NSC festzulegen, wie Gesundheit, Stimmung und Ziele. Verwenden Sie dann Entscheidungsbäume oder endliche Automaten, um ihre Aktionen basierend auf diesen Attributen zu bestimmen. Dieser Ansatz ermöglicht es den NSCs, sich realistisch zu verhalten, ohne umfangreiche manuelle Programmierung, wodurch wertvolle Entwicklungszeit für andere Aspekte des Spiels freigegeben wird.

Umweltinteraktionen verbessern

KI-Agenten können auch verwendet werden, um Umgebungen zum Leben zu erwecken. Egal, ob es sich um Wetter-, Tierverhaltens- oder dynamische Geländesysteme handelt, KI kann Schichten der Komplexität hinzufügen, die die Spielwelt organischer und reaktiver machen. In einem Projekt haben wir ein KI-gesteuertes Wettersystem implementiert, das die Sichtbarkeit und das Verhalten von NSCs beeinflusste und eine immersivere Atmosphäre schuf. Die Wettermodelle wurden aus Daten der realen Welt generiert und dynamisch angepasst, je nach dem Fortschritt der Spielhandlung.

Um ähnliche Ergebnisse zu erzielen, ziehen Sie in Betracht, KI-Agenten zur Modellierung umweltbezogener Elemente wie Wind, Regen oder Wildtierbewegungen zu verwenden. Zum Beispiel kann ein einfacher KI-Algorithmus bestimmen, wie Tiere Nahrung suchen oder vor Raubtieren fliehen, und ein glaubwürdiges Ökosystem schaffen, das auf die Anwesenheit des Spielers reagiert. Diese Interaktionen können die Tiefe des Gameplays erhöhen und die Spieler dazu anregen, ihre Umgebung bedeutungsvoller zu erkunden und zu interagieren.

Prozedurale Inhaltserzeugung

Die prozedurale Inhaltserzeugung ist ein weiteres Gebiet, in dem KI-Agenten glänzen. Durch den Einsatz von Algorithmen zur Erstellung von Levels, Objekten oder Quests in Echtzeit können Sie den Spielern jedes Mal, wenn sie spielen, ein einzigartiges Erlebnis bieten. In einem Roguelike-Spiel, das ich entwickelt habe, haben wir KI-Agenten eingesetzt, um Dungeon-Layouts und die Platzierung von Feinden zu erzeugen, sodass jede Partie frisch und unvorhersehbar wirkt.

Um die prozedurale Erzeugung umzusetzen, beginnen Sie mit der Festlegung der Regeln und Parameter für Ihre Inhalte. Für die Dungeon-Erstellung können dies Raumgrößen, Feindtypen oder die Verteilung von Beute umfassen. Verwenden Sie dann KI-Agenten, um diese Elemente innerhalb der festgelegten Parameter zu randomisieren und das Gleichgewicht und die Kohärenz zu gewährleisten. Dieser Ansatz spart nicht nur Zeit, sondern hilft auch, das Interesse der Spieler durch abwechslungsreiche Spielerlebnisse aufrechtzuerhalten.

KI-Agenten effektiv integrieren

Obwohl KI-Agenten viele Vorteile bieten, erfordert ihre Integration in Ihr Spiel sorgfältige Planung und Ausführung. Hier sind einige Tipps für eine reibungslose Implementierung:

Klein anfangen und schrittweise wachsen

KI-Agenten können komplex sein, daher ist es wichtig, mit kleinen und überschaubaren Aufgaben zu beginnen. Setzen Sie die KI zuerst für einen einzelnen NSC oder ein umweltbezogenes Element um, und erweitern Sie dann schrittweise, während Sie sich mit der Technologie vertrautmachen. Dieser iterative Ansatz ermöglicht es Ihnen, Ihre Systeme zu verfeinern und potenzielle Probleme frühzeitig zu erkennen.

Vorhandene Frameworks und Tools nutzen

Es gibt viele verfügbare Frameworks und Tools, die den Prozess der Implementierung von KI-Agenten vereinfachen können. Die KI-Funktionen von Unity, die Verhaltensbäume von Unreal Engine oder Open-Source-Bibliotheken wie TensorFlow können eine solide Grundlage für Ihre KI-Systeme bieten. Durch die Nutzung dieser Ressourcen können Sie vermeiden, das Rad neu zu erfinden, und sich auf die kreativen Aspekte Ihres Spiels konzentrieren.

Testen und iterieren

Tests sind entscheidend, wenn Sie mit KI-Agenten arbeiten. Testen Sie Ihr Spiel regelmäßig, um sicherzustellen, dass die KI-Verhaltensweisen wie vorgesehen funktionieren und das gewünschte Erlebnis bieten. Sammeln Sie Feedback und seien Sie bereit, an Ihren Designs zu iterieren. KI kann manchmal unerwartete Ergebnisse erzeugen, daher sind Flexibilität und Anpassungsfähigkeit für eine erfolgreiche Integration entscheidend.

Fazit: Die Zukunft der KI in unabhängigen Spielen

KI-Agenten revolutionieren den Markt für die Entwicklung unabhängiger Spiele und bieten neue Möglichkeiten, fesselnde und dynamische Erlebnisse zu schaffen, ohne massive Budgets zu benötigen. Durch die durchdachte Integration von KI in Ihre Spiele können Sie Welten erschaffen, die lebendig und reaktiv erscheinen, und die Fantasie von Spielern auf der ganzen Welt fesseln. Während sich die KI-Technologie weiterentwickelt, bin ich gespannt, wie unabhängige Entwickler die Grenzen des Spiels erweitern und sowohl neue als auch relevante Erfahrungen schaffen werden.

Verwandte Links: Beste KI-Agentenplattformen für Startups · Wie OpenClaw WebSockets behandelt: Ein Einblick eines Entwicklers · Navigation durch die Lebenszyklus-Hooks von OpenClaw-Plugins

🕒 Published:

👨‍💻
Written by Jake Chen

Developer advocate for the OpenClaw ecosystem. Writes tutorials, maintains SDKs, and helps developers ship AI agents faster.

Learn more →
Browse Topics: Architecture | Community | Contributing | Core Development | Customization
Scroll to Top